WebFeb 26, 2024 · FXYD1 (phospholemman) and FXYD5 (dysadherin) are the most abundant FXYDs in skeletal muscle [ 16 ]. FXYD1 inhibits NKA by reducing its affinity for Na + [ 11, 17 ], which can be reversed by phosphorylation of FXYD1 at Ser 63 and Ser 68 [ 10, 11, 18, 19 ], while FXYD5 increases Vmax of NKA [ 10, 20 ].
